On March 19th, Representative George Miller (D-CA) introduced the Foster Opportunities for Success Through Higher Education Reform Act to provide help with educational services and college opportunities for children in foster care. In his announcement, Rep. Miller referenced work by the Center and several other organizations. Read the press release (2 pgs, 39.5 kb, 3/04). Read the Bill (11 pgs, 44.7 kb, 3/04).
